What electronics are you using?
Typically Bartolini pickups and preamp (usually the 2-band model) but I am
about to ship a 5-string Jazz-style that has an Audere preamp, which is also
very good stuff.
The fretless has pickups that were hand-wound for me by Kent Armstrong,
as well as a Wilkinson 2-band preamp.
I've put Armstrong's hand-made pickups in three basses so far - and all have
been excellent. He made the MM-style soapbars for my own 5-string bass,
as well as the dual-coil jazz style pickups for the aforementioned
Jazz-style
bass.
